#include <stdio.h>
|
||||
#include <tvm_runtime.h>
|
||||
#include <tvmgen_rec.h>
|
||||
|
||||
#include "uart.h"
|
||||
|
||||
// Header files generated by convert_image.py
|
||||
#include "inputs.h"
|
||||
#include "outputs.h"
|
||||
|
||||
int main(int argc, char **argv) {
|
||||
char dict[] = {"#0123456789:;<=>?@ABCDEFGHIJKLMNOPQRSTUVWXYZ[\\]^_`"
|
||||
"abcdefghijklmnopqrstuvwxyz{|}~!\"#$%&'()*+,-./ "};
|
||||
int char_dict_nums = 97;
|
||||
uart_init();
|
||||
printf("Starting ocr rec inference\n");
|
||||
struct tvmgen_rec_outputs rec_outputs = {
|
||||
.output = output,
|
||||
};
|
||||
struct tvmgen_rec_inputs rec_inputs = {
|
||||
.x = input,
|
||||
};
|
||||
|
||||
tvmgen_rec_run(&rec_inputs, &rec_outputs);
|
||||
|
||||
// post process
|
||||
int char_nums = output_len / char_dict_nums;
|
||||
|
||||
int last_index = 0;
|
||||
float score = 0.f;
|
||||
int count = 0;
|
||||
|
||||
printf("text: ");
|
||||
for (int i = 0; i < char_nums; i++) {
|
||||
int argmax_idx = 0;
|
||||
float max_value = 0.0f;
|
||||
for (int j = 0; j < char_dict_nums; j++) {
|
||||
if (output[i * char_dict_nums + j] > max_value) {
|
||||
max_value = output[i * char_dict_nums + j];
|
||||
argmax_idx = j;
|
||||
}
|
||||
}
|
||||
if (argmax_idx > 0 && (!(i > 0 && argmax_idx == last_index))) {
|
||||
score += max_value;
|
||||
count += 1;
|
||||
// printf("%d,%f,%c\n", argmax_idx, max_value, dict[argmax_idx]);
|
||||
printf("%c", dict[argmax_idx]);
|
||||
}
|
||||
last_index = argmax_idx;
|
||||
}
|
||||
score /= count;
|
||||
printf(", score: %f\n", score);
|
||||
|
||||
// The FVP will shut down when it receives "EXITTHESIM" on the UART
|
||||
printf("EXITTHESIM\n");
|
||||
while (1 == 1)
|
||||
;
|
||||
return 0;
|
||||
}
